2020年12月9日
摘要: 一、功能调查与系统功能框架图 1.功能调查 集美大学图书管理系统,大致分为查询,借阅,归还,管理员可在后台对图书进行添加,删除,修改(修改数量或信息录入错误的修改) 2.功能框架图 二、类的设计 三、 类说明 Test类:菜单:选择用户和管理员 Person类:储存身份信息:用户名,ID,含方法ge 阅读全文
posted @ 2020-12-09 20:26 lim-M 阅读(115) 评论(0) 推荐(0) 编辑
  2020年10月25日
摘要: #####一、 StudenDaoListImpl.java与StudentDaoArrayImpl.java有何不同? 前者使用链表进行数据的储存,增添删除比较方便,后者使用数组,遍历时要判断数组是否为空。 #####二、StudentDao.java文件是干什么用的?为什么里面什么实现代码都没有 阅读全文
posted @ 2020-10-25 18:52 lim-M 阅读(58) 评论(0) 推荐(0) 编辑
  2020年10月4日
摘要: #####一、有理数类代码 package text; public class Rational { private long numerator = 0; //分子 private long denominator = 1; //分母 public Rational() { //构造函数 thi 阅读全文
posted @ 2020-10-04 11:18 lim-M 阅读(49) 评论(0) 推荐(0) 编辑
  2020年5月17日
摘要: 一、图 邻接矩阵 邻接表 十字链表:查找进入或离开顶点的弧都容易;求顶点的出度和入度方便;建立十字链表时间复杂度与邻接表相同 邻接多重表:同一条边只对应一个边结点,避免数据冗余;建立邻接多重表时间复杂度与邻接表相同,且各种基本操作实现也与邻接表相似 二、图的应用 拓扑算法 图用邻接矩阵存储; 二 阅读全文
posted @ 2020-05-17 17:34 lim-M 阅读(132) 评论(0) 推荐(0) 编辑
  2020年4月26日
摘要: 一、树 树的基本操作 二、二叉树 最优二叉树:哈夫曼树 在所有含 n 个叶子结点、并带相同权值的 m 叉树中,必存在一棵其带权路径长度取最小值的树,称为“最优树” (赫夫曼算法) 以二叉树为例: ⑴根据给定的 n 个权值 {w1, w2, …, wn},构造 n 棵二叉树的集合F = {T1, T2 阅读全文
posted @ 2020-04-26 21:58 lim-M 阅读(154) 评论(0) 推荐(0) 编辑
摘要: 一、编辑器与编译器有什么区别?有什么好用的编辑器? 1.编辑器 文本编辑器(或称文字编辑器)是用作编写普通文字的应用软件,它与文档编辑器(或称文字处理器)不同之处在于它并非用作桌面排版(例如文档格式处理),它常用来编写程序的源代码 2.编译器 编译器就是将“一种语言(通常为高级语言)”翻译为“另一种 阅读全文
posted @ 2020-04-26 20:37 lim-M 阅读(275) 评论(0) 推荐(0) 编辑
  2020年4月19日
摘要: SearchBST(T, key) 伪代码&&代码 InsertBST(T, key) 伪代码&&代码 CreateBST(T) 伪代码&&代码 DeleteBST(T, key) 伪代码&&代码 完整代码 运行结果 阅读全文
posted @ 2020-04-19 21:55 lim-M 阅读(132) 评论(0) 推荐(0) 编辑
  2020年3月28日
摘要: 一、数据结构 1.存储结构是逻辑结构是映射 2.逻辑结构与存储结构的关系 ◼ 存储结构是逻辑结构在计算机中的存储形式 ◼ 同一逻辑结构可以对应多种存储结构 ◼ 同样的操作在不同的存储结构上,实现方法不同 二、算法 1.递归O()计算: 2. ​ ◼时间复杂度的关系: ​ O(1)next = NUL 阅读全文
posted @ 2020-03-28 21:30 lim-M 阅读(119) 评论(0) 推荐(0) 编辑
  2019年12月21日
摘要: 完整代码 2.运行截图 任务二: 任务三: 拓展: 通过system函数调用DOS命令 ASSOC 显示或修改文件扩展名关联。 AT 计划在计算机上运行的命令和程序。 ATTRIB 显示或更改文件属性。 BREAK 设置或清除扩展式CTRL+C 检查。 CACLS 显示或修改文件的访问控制列表(AC 阅读全文
posted @ 2019-12-21 18:02 lim-M 阅读(101) 评论(0) 推荐(0) 编辑
  2019年11月10日
摘要: 一、运行截图 二、介绍函数 1. 菜单 2. 将十进制转化成二进制 3. 将十进制转化为二进制 4. 将十进制转化为八进制 5. 八进制转化为十进制 6. 将二进制转化成十进制,再将十进制转换成八进制 7. 将八进制转换成十进制,再将十进制转换成二进制 8. 将十进制转换成十六进制 9. 将十六进制 阅读全文
posted @ 2019-11-10 18:52 lim-M 阅读(161) 评论(0) 推荐(0) 编辑